After investing in a high performance structured cabling system, the final and most crucial step is certification. Simply seeing an internet connection is not a real test; it does not tell you if your network can handle high traffic loads or if it meets the strict performance standards you paid for. We offer a comprehensive suite of testing services for both newly installed and existing network infrastructures.
Industry Standard Equipment: We exclusively use professionally maintained and regularly calibrated Fluke Networks equipment, such as the DSX-5000 and DSX-8000.
Professional Documentation: For every single cable tested, you receive a detailed PDF report that serves as a permanent record and “birth certificate” for your network.
Expert Fault Finding: Our engineers are skilled in interpreting complex results to diagnose root causes like poorly terminated connectors or cable kinks.
Unbiased Reporting: The detailed pass or fail reports are generated directly by the equipment, offering an objective assessment of your network health.
